
Voters resoundingly backed paid sick leave. Now lawmakers in 3 states want to roll back the benefits
By DAVID A. LIEB, MARGERY A. BECK and BECKY BOHRER Associated Press JEFFERSON CITY, Mo. (AP) — Voters in Alaska, Missouri and Nebraska were asked last year whether they wanted to require employers to provide paid sick leave to their workers. They overwhelmingly said yes.
